The short version

Garden City has roughly average household income, with a median household income of $50,454. Population has declined 9% since 2000. 17%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 28%. Median home value is $102,100. At a median age of 30.2, residents skew younger than the country as a whole.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Garden City, KS?

Garden City, KS has about 36,776 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Garden City, KS?

The typical household in Garden City, KS earns about $50,454 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Garden City, KS expensive?

In Garden City, KS, the median home is worth about $102,100, and the typical rent is about $599 a month.

How educated are people in Garden City, KS?

About 17.3% of adults age 25 and over in Garden City, KS h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Garden City, KS?

About 14.1% of people in Garden City, KS live below the federal poverty line.
